Skip to main content

Ruby Developer

Technology
Mercor
US$104,000 - US$176,800 /year1 months agoUntil 07/05/2026
Part timeFully remote

Job description

  • *About The Job
  • *Mercor
connects elite creative and technical talent with leading AI research labs. Headquartered in San Francisco, our investors include
  • *Benchmark**
,
  • *General Catalyst**
,
  • *Peter Thiel**
,
  • *Adam D'Angelo**
,
  • *Larry Summers**
, and
  • *Jack Dorsey**
.
  • *Position:**

Ruby Developer

  • *Type:
  • *Part-time / Contract
  • Compensation:
  • $50–$85/hour
  • *Commitment:
  • *10–20 hours/week
  • *Role Responsibilities
  • Design challenging coding problems with clear input/output specs, constraints, and explicit function signatures.
  • Develop complete mini-repos, including problem statements, reference solutions, comprehensive unit tests (10–20 cases), and executable test runners.
  • Implement clean, production-quality Ruby code aligned strictly with test expectations.
  • Write high-coverage tests covering edge cases, invalid inputs, and performance constraints.
  • Ensure full executability with no missing gems, dependency conflicts, or configuration mismatches.
  • *Qualifications
  • *Must-Have
  • 3–6 years of backend development experience in Ruby.
  • Strong proficiency in Ruby, including OOP principles and idiomatic Ruby practices.
  • Hands-on experience with Ruby on Rails, Sinatra, or similar frameworks.
  • Experience building and maintaining RESTful APIs.
  • Working knowledge of MVC architecture and service-oriented design.
  • Experience with databases: PostgreSQL, MySQL, MongoDB.
  • Experience writing unit and integration tests using RSpec or Minitest.
  • Familiarity with Bundler, Docker, and basic CI/CD workflows (GitHub Actions or similar).
  • Strong understanding of clean code, modular design, and test-driven development.
  • Comfortable working with Git-based collaboration (PRs, issues, reviews).
  • *Application Process (Takes 20–30 mins to complete)
  • Upload resume
  • AI interview based on your resume
  • Submit form
  • *Resources & Support**
  • For details about the interview process and platform information, please check: https://talent.docs.mercor.com/welcome/welcome
  • For any help or support, reach out to: support@mercor.com
  • PS: Our team reviews applications daily. Please complete your AI interview and application steps to be considered for this opportunity.*
,
Keywords
rubybenchmarkcatalystidiomaticrailssinatrapostgresqlmysqlmongodbrspecbundlerdockergithubgithub-actions

¿Te interesa este puesto?